Many people prefer to grow a vegetable garden alternatively because the work involved is much more gratifying. Because you might find yourself spending considerable time researching and learning, it will be very rewarding in the end. Over the entire year, it is wise to be able to find a vegetable that'll be growing. If you plan meticulously, you will understand exactly what vegetables it is possible to grow in what season. You might decide to expand your garden and grow numerous types of vegetables. When one plant is out of season, an alternative one is just starting up. The nice thing about a vegetable garden is not having to spend too much effort perfecting it, and it brings in produce to eat.

If you prefer a big challenge, then a fruit garden is one thing you might like to consider. The fruits you are going to generate will entice a variety of pests so you will be spending much of your time keeping them at bay. For the plants to produce, the garden soil needs to be just right, and a fruit garden will probably not produce the whole year. It's a lot of work, but when you love fruit, it really is worth it.

Exactly what you choose for your garden is going to be determined by how much work you want to invest, and what product you want. In the event you don't want to put too much effort but desire something beautiful, then a flower garden would be good for you. If you want a challenge and have something scrumptious and sweet, then some sort of fruit garden may be for you. Make certain you consider the amount of time and effort you would like to spend before deciding what type of garden you want.

Using structures such as pillars, gazebos, and arbors can change your garden and make it seem significantly larger than it really is. When using these elements, you can create the look of a classic garden by growing climbing plants that will cling to the structures. Putting in wind sculptures and statuaries can certainly bolster the look of your landscape. Adding bird feeders or bird baths will certainly draw in living things to your garden. Drawing birds to your garden will perk up the ambience. Architectural structures contrasted with natural features, like trees and scrubs establish a good sense of balance. Nature becomes more friendly and welcoming when complemented with artificial structures.

You can utilize obelisks and trellises that will help inhibit views of unwanted structures. Interferences can't be eliminated completely, so creating a perfect view will not be possible. Nevertheless eyesores might be blocked once you install these structures, and a trellis can support a clinging vine. The sounds of water dripping or spilling originating from a fountain or pond will help you to chill out in your garden. Fountains can create a wonderful atmosphere in which to practice meditation. If your budget permits, you may choose to set up an imposing system instead of a lower cost simple rock fountain.
